Bars from 22 cities around the continent make this year's edition of the extended list
Asia's 50 Best Bars have revealed the third edition of its 51-100 list, bringing the spotlight to an extended selection of bars as voted by the organisation's 260-member Academy that is made up of bartenders, bar owners, drinks writers and cocktail aficionados. This list comes just one week ahead of the highly anticipated annual Asia's 50 Best Bars revelation, which is set to take place in Hong Kong on July 18.

This year's list sees bars from 22 Asian cities, including first-timers Okinawa and Kumamoto. Singapore leads the pack with eight bars, while Hong Kong boasts five bars on the list. Bangkok and Kuala Lumpur are both represented by four bars each. Bars from cities including Tainan, Taiwan; Goa, India; Nara, Japan; and Semarang, Indonesia, also appear on the list.
Notable new entries include Singapore's The Elephant Room at #64, Night Hawk at #73, Offtrack at #79, and Origin Bar & Grill at #95. Across the causeway in Kuala Lumpur, Reka also makes its first appearance on the list, coming in at #65.
Osaka, Okinawa, and Kumamoto also broke onto the list with Craftroom (#62), El Lequio (#80) and Yakoboku (#84), respectively. In Bangkok, Opium makes its debut at #59.
